Merely specified, device control is a system that calculates the position of the device on a piece of equipment like the container of an excavator or the blade of a bulldozer and, using a screen, lets the equipment operator recognize specifically what's going on. It tells you exactly how much planet has actually been gotten and if you have actually satisfied the target deepness required for your road, as an example.




Here we provide an overview of machine control and automation and rundown five reasons why heavy building can profit from fact capture, whether you are a driver, an engineer, or a project proprietor. We generally divided maker control right into two categories.


The 3D style typically is available in the type of triangulated surface area versions or digital surface models (DTM), which are posted utilizing a USB stick in the case of a solitary device, or even more easily for several devices, via, a cloud-based system for sharing information that can be handled centrally.

Device automation does the exact same estimations for the placement however has an included interface that takes some of the work out of the operator's hands. By utilizing hydraulics or connecting to systems on the equipment, device automation can position the equipment itself and meet the preferred value, such as excavating to the right deepness.


The trend in the sector is for assistance systems to end up being more and much more automated. Usually, device control needs some instruments to position itself, and there are a couple of ways of doing this. In basic cases, if you're just concerned with elevation, for example, you can make use of a rotating laser. We refer to this as a 2D maker control system. You can use a total terminal tor laser scanner to get setting and elevation, which is real 3D device control.


Finally, one of the most common placing kind for device control is GNSS, which will certainly place the equipment to 3D precision of roughly 30mm. In all these cases, the initial positioning is refrained from doing to the placement of the tool itself, so there are other sensing units set up to move the position where the sensor rests on the rear of the maker to the contact factor of the tool.

Exceeding merely giving operators with a visual overview to bucket or blade setting, automated machine control moves the blade to grade by speaking to the machine's hydraulics. Unlike with routine maker control, automated maker control modern technology places the obligation for precision and rate securely in the hands of performance-enhancing technology.

When looking at the current construction landscape, it is clear that, regardless of its substantial benefits, machine control automation is not being adopted across all makers at an equal price (https://www.4shared.com/u/UVBIUR4K/floydoverbeck4500.html). Although automation is being welcomed on machines like graders and dozers, the uptake has been much slower for excavators, with the fostering rate of automated machine control on these makers still approximated at around 10% in Europe in comparison to a price of over 50% for dozers.
